    Making Your Strawberry Banana Smoothie:

    Step 1 – Gather and measure the ingredients.  (see tips & substitutions below)

    ingredients for strawberry banana smoothie on counter.

    I usually purchase a big bag of organic frozen strawberries at the grocery store for ease in making smoothies.  Plus, they tend to be more cost-effective.

    Slice the banana into about one-inch pieces.

    ingredients for strawberry banana smoothie on counter.

    Step 2- Add all the ingredients to a blender.

    Smoothie ingredients in blender container and sliced bananas on counter.

    Step 3 – Blend the ingredients until smooth and creamy.  This should take about one minute depending on your blender.

    Strawberry Banana Smoothie in blender container.

    Step 4 – Pour into a glass and enjoy.  This smoothie yields two cups, which is one larger smoothie for one serving or two smaller smoothies for two servings.

    Vegan Strawberry Banana Smoothie Tips and Substitutions:

    1. Make sure one fruit is frozen.   So if you have fresh strawberries, then use frozen banana or vice versa. This will yield a more milkshake type creaminess.
    2. Add a few ice cubes if the smoothie is too thin.
    3. Add more liquid (dairy-free milk or water) if the smoothie is too thick.
    4. Do not add sugar – the smoothie is sweet enough.
    5. This strawberry smoothie can be stored in the refrigerator for later (but best used within the same day).
    6. Boost your smoothie by adding some hemp seeds, chia seeds, flax seeds, some greens (spinach) or extra berries.

    The BEST Strawberry Banana Smoothie!
    Prep Time
    5 mins
    Total Time
    5 mins
     

    An easy Strawberry Banana Smoothie that has only three ingredients and takes less than five minutes to make?  This dairy-free and vegan smoothie are kid-friendly and gluten-free!  Whee!

    Course: Breakfast, Smoothie, Snack
    Cuisine: American, Breakfast
    Servings: 1
    Calories: 168 kcal
    Author: Christine Galvani
    Ingredients
    • 1 banana
    • 1 cup strawberries (I used organic frozen strawberries)
    • 1/2 cup almond milk (or your favorite milk)
    Instructions
    1. Place all ingredients in a blender and blend for a few minutes until the mixture becomes smooth, creamy and your desired consistency.

    2. Pour smoothie into a glass and enjoy!

    3. Smoothie can be prepared ahead and stored in the refrigerator for later.

    Recipe Notes
    1. Make sure one fruit is frozen.   So if you have fresh strawberries, then use frozen banana or vice versa. This will yield a more milkshake type creaminess.
    2. Add a few ice cubes if the smoothie is too thin.
    3. Add more liquid (dairy-free milk or water) if the smoothie is too thick.
    4. Do not add sugar - the smoothie is sweet enough.
    5. This strawberry smoothie can be stored in the refrigerator for later (but best used within the same day).
    6. Boost your smoothie by adding some hemp seeds, chia seeds, flax seeds, some greens (spinach) or extra berries.
